Dr. Natalia Kornejewa writes: "We were not enrolled at the Faculty of Psychology of Moscow University because we had an exceptionally high level of knowledge, but because our teachers placed their trust in us, believing that science could develop our psyche to its highest richness, even if we could neither see nor hear." I had the privilege of learning from Prof. L. F. Obuchova for forty years what it means to work scientifically. She accomplished the miracle of having her deafblind students work as doctoral-level psychology educators. As parents, we place our trust in our children. For we have understood during training sessions that our children can also develop their psyche to its highest richness when they experience ontogenetic education. This education precedes the development of all children. Science is tender. Tenderness is scientific. Christel Manske.
